What are the nutritional benefits of Gala apples?

Gala apples are a fantastic source of several essential nutrients. They're packed with vitamins, minerals, and fiber, all contributing to overall health and well-being. A medium-sized Gala apple (approximately 182 grams) provides roughly:

  • Fiber: Around 4.4 grams, contributing to digestive health and helping you feel full and satisfied. This fiber content aids in regulating blood sugar levels and promoting a healthy gut microbiome.
  • Vitamin C: A good source of this powerful antioxidant, crucial for immune function and collagen production.
  • Vitamin K: While not as abundant as Vitamin C, Gala apples still offer a small amount of this vitamin, essential for blood clotting and bone health.
  • Potassium: This electrolyte plays a vital role in maintaining healthy blood pressure and fluid balance.

Beyond these key nutrients, Gala apples contain smaller amounts of other vitamins and minerals, contributing to a well-rounded nutritional profile.

Are Gala apples good for weight loss?

This is a question many people ask. While no single food magically melts away pounds, Gala apples can certainly be a valuable part of a weight-management strategy. Their high fiber content promotes satiety, meaning you'll feel fuller for longer, potentially reducing overall calorie intake. The natural sweetness also helps curb cravings for sugary snacks, making them a healthier alternative. However, remember that weight loss is a holistic process requiring a balanced diet and regular exercise.

How many calories are in a Gala apple?

A medium-sized Gala apple typically contains around 95 calories. This makes it a relatively low-calorie snack, especially when compared to many processed alternatives. The calorie count can slightly vary depending on the size of the apple.

What are the health benefits of eating Gala apples?

The health benefits extend beyond simple nutrition. The antioxidants in Gala apples, particularly Vitamin C, help protect your cells from damage caused by free radicals. This contributes to overall health and may reduce the risk of chronic diseases. The fiber content supports healthy digestion and can help prevent constipation. Furthermore, the potassium in Gala apples plays a role in maintaining healthy blood pressure.

Are Gala apples good for your skin?

The antioxidants in Gala apples contribute to healthy skin. Vitamin C is essential for collagen production, a protein vital for maintaining skin elasticity and reducing wrinkles. The antioxidants also help protect your skin from damage caused by sun exposure and environmental pollutants. While apples alone won't magically transform your skin, incorporating them into a healthy diet can certainly contribute to a radiant complexion.
